8 points is equal to approximately 10.6667 pixels.

The conversion from points to pixels is based on the fact that 1 point equals 1/72 of an inch, and pixels depend on screen resolution, commonly 96 pixels per inch. Therefore, multiplying points by 96/72 converts it to pixels. For 8 points, this calculation gives the pixel value shown above.

Conversion Formula

The formula used to convert points to pixels is:

pixels = points × (96 / 72)

Points are a measurement often used in printing and typography where 1 point equals 1/72 of an inch. Pixels represent dots on a digital screen, where 1 inch usually equals 96 pixels. By multiplying the point value by the ratio of pixels per inch to points per inch (96/72), you get the equivalent pixel value.

Example calculation for 8 points:

  • Start with 8 points
  • Multiply by 96 (pixels per inch): 8 × 96 = 768
  • Divide by 72 (points per inch): 768 ÷ 72 = 10.6667 pixels

Conversion Definitions

Points: A point is a typographic measurement that equals 1/72 of an inch. Used in print and digital design to specify font size, spacing, and layout. It provides a consistent unit for measuring lengths on physical media or screen layouts regardless of resolution.

Pixels: A pixel is the smallest unit of a digital image or display screen, representing one dot or point of light. Pixels form the images on screens, and their size depends on the device’s resolution, often measured in pixels per inch (PPI) or dots per inch (DPI).

Conversion FAQs

Does the pixel value of 8 points change with screen resolution?

Yes, pixels depend on screen resolution which means the conversion from points to pixels can vary. The standard formula assumes 96 pixels per inch, but some screens have higher or lower pixel density which changes the pixel count for 8 points.

Why use 96 and 72 in points to pixels conversion?

72 points per inch is a traditional print measurement while 96 pixels per inch is common for computer displays. These numbers come from historical standards for print and screen resolution, so the formula uses their ratio to convert between the two units.

Can I rely on points to pixels conversion in responsive web design?

Points to pixels conversion gives a fixed pixel size, but responsive design usually adapts sizes based on screen size and resolution. So while this conversion helps, it may not be perfect for all devices without additional scaling or CSS techniques.

How precise is the calculation of 8 points to pixels?

The calculation 8 × 96 ÷ 72 equals 10.6667 pixels, which is a precise theoretical value. However, screen rendering may round this number causing slight differences in actual display size depending on the browser or device.

What happens if I convert negative points to pixels?

Negative points convert to negative pixels mathematically, which can be used in some graphical transformations or offsets. But physically, negative sizes do not exist, so this is usually for calculations or programming scenarios.
